What vegetables to plant in spring and summer?

There were many types of vegetables suitable for planting in spring and summer. Amaranth was a common seasonal vegetable in spring, summer, and autumn. It was nutritious, fresh, and sweet. It did not have high requirements for soil and was easy to grow and manage. It could be planted in spring, summer, autumn, and winter. It could also be planted in spring and summer. It did not have high requirements for planting conditions and preferred low temperature and humid environments. Cabbage did not have high requirements for soil and environment. It could grow well in both low and high temperature environments and was suitable for planting in all seasons, including spring and summer. Chives could basically be planted all year round, and they could grow well in spring and summer. In addition, summer was also suitable for planting okra, cowpea, water spinach, wood ear cabbage, arugula, chili and other vegetables. Okra could be sown directly in summer without sprouting, and it could sprout quickly. Cowpea was more advantageous in summer than in spring, and it could sprout quickly and rarely cause seedling diseases. Water Spinach was a typical summer vegetable, and it was not afraid of heat and rain. Wood ear vegetable was not afraid of heat and humidity, and there were few pests and diseases. The higher the temperature, the more lush it grew. Arugula was particularly heat-resistant, and there were basically no pests and diseases throughout the growth period. Spring vegetables, seasonal vegetables

There were many kinds of vegetables in season in spring. In the north, spring vegetables mainly referred to lettuce. Its stem was edible, and it tasted crisp and nutritious. The common method was to stir-fry shredded pork with lettuce. Chives were also a common seasonal vegetable in spring. It was cold in winter and rarely needed to be sprayed with pesticide. It was delicious and nutritious. Common ways to eat it were to stir-fry chives with eggs, stir-fry bean sprouts with chives, and so on. Chrysanthemum had a special fragrance and was rich in nutritional fiber; Chinese toon was called a vegetable on the tree. It was rich in nutrients and had high medicinal value. For example, Chinese toon scrambled eggs were very delicious; celery had medicinal effects and was rich in nutritional fiber. In addition, shepherd's purse could be used to make bamboo shoots and shepherd's purse salad; spinach could be used to make spinach egg rolls; garlic moss was not only relatively cheap in spring, but also delicious. The common way to eat it was to stir-fry garlic moss with meat. In the south, wild vegetables that were commonly seen in spring could be called spring vegetables. In the Lingnan area, wild amaranth such as "spring wormwood" was called spring vegetables. Cabbage moss was a green vegetable that could be eaten more in spring. Its stem was large, its stem was white, the distance between the leaves was large, and it was fresh, tender, and sweet. It was cultivated in many places. Fruit and Vegetables Sorter

The vegetable and fruit sorters were employees responsible for sorting, packaging, loading and unloading vegetables and fruits. They needed to sort the products according to the specified standards and ensure that the packaging and quality met the requirements. The sorting work usually required standing work, and the working time could be as long as 10 to 16 hours a day. It required a certain amount of physical strength and endurance. According to the information provided, the work of the vegetable and fruit sorters included the selection, placement, loading and unloading of goods, sorting, packing, and delivery of goods, as well as the inspection, supervision, and inventory of materials in the warehouse. The job requirements included obeying the work arrangements of the leader, strictly abiding by the company's rules and regulations, keeping secrets, and completing other temporary tasks assigned by the superior on time. According to the information provided, the work of vegetable and fruit sorters could be tiring, especially when working in hot, humid, or cold environments.
